Jasen Anthony Montoya passed through the pearly gates Monday, October 12, 2020.  Jasen is survived by one son Aric; two daughters Karma and Autumn; parents, Tony and Brenda; one "dorky" sister, Jodi Bradshaw and husband Joey; one nephew, Ryan Mitchell; two nieces, Rayna and Cloey Bradshaw, Katelyn Blakely, Jordan Montoya and a host of others who claim him as well as Aunt Nancy, Uncle Jim, many cousins, and about a kazillion friends.

Born in Linden December 2, 1977, Jasen grew up forming lifelong friendships with his little league teammates and school buddies.  He was an avid UT fan, "Hook'Em Horns", loved to cook (probably a result of sitting in a pillow-stuffed cardboard box on the cabinet at six months old watching Mama Bea cook), music, drawing, and coaching his girls softball teams.  He loved to entertain friends and family from lip sync battles to guitar hero, while creating a feast on the grill, or the stove.

Remember the good times shared with Jasen, shed a tear or two, miss him a lot, but celebrate his life well lived.

Services will be 2:00 p.m., Sunday, October 18, 2020 at New Colony Baptist Church with Bro. Claude Crocker officiating.  Burial to follow in the New Colony Cemetery under the direction of Reeder-Davis Funeral Home in Linden.

There will be a time of visitation from 6:00 until 8:00 p.m., Saturday evening at the funeral home.
